• Tuesday, August 7, 2007 - Whats been going on

Well today sure was a truly wild one.    We started back to school yesterday and all went well.   Then today, schooling wasn`t the problem, but the chicken coop was.     We had done a couple of our subjects and I told the kids I needed to go out feed and water the chickens.  We go out there and I am putting feed into the feeder and one of my hens gets out the door on me.  She takes off.  I am unable to let my chickens run free because of my dogs.  Matter of fact, I lost two hens last week because my dog got loose and pulled them though the pen.   So here she is, flying around and us chasing after her.   She takes off and goes in to the weeds and I am not able to get her.  All I kept thinking is I am going to find a big snake, or the kids would.  I figured she is gone and I would not see her again.   I went back to the feed, so I could get feed for my chickens at the barn.  Just as I went to step down, there was this huge black snake, eating a rat.    Which at the time I didn`t know at the time.  I have a hoe and I am poking it with this hoe and I guess I made it mad.  Because it was striking at the hoe.( I forgot to mention it was under some old lumber and at first I was poking at it tail.  It was after I moved the lumber, when I saw the  rat.)  Well it takes off under the chicken coop and I was afraid to jump down because I just knew it would get me.  But it didn`t.
Well after that, we went back in to finish up school.   About an hour had went by and I looked out to check on my chickens and sure enough my hen was out there trying to get back in.  I went out and got her and return her with the others.   
Now with all that over and done with.   I started to go to the store and I was out of checks.  So I went to look for them and  I guess I have misplaced a whole box of checks.    Oh well maybe tomorrow will be   better.   
I did manage to get a baby quilt top pieced this weekend and I hope to get it quilted this weekend.  I am going to hand quilt it.   It might take two weekends.

Well I didn`t get much out of the garden.  I did manage to get some corn put up and I may have some ready tomorrow.   Everything around here is just dying.    We get rain but just not enough.   Our creeks have been dried up for sometime now.   Oh well there is next year.   
On the goats,  I did sell my billy goat.   I now just have my three nanny goats.
